Altynai Omurbekova

Biography

Altynai Seitbekovna was born in 1973 in Frunze (now Bishkek). She graduated from the Faculties of History and Law of the Kyrgyz State University.

From 2000 to 2008, she was engaged in business activities.

In 2009-2010, she was Lawyer at the Department of Land Management and Registration of Rights to Immovable Property in the Alamudun District of Bishkek.

From 2010 to 2011, she was Deputy, Deputy Chairman of the Committee on Health Care, Social Policy, Labor and Migration of the Jogorku Kenesh of the Kyrgyz Republic.

In 2011, she was Head of the Administration of the Leninsky District of Bishkek.

In 2013, she was Acting Head of the Administration of the Sverdlovsk District of Bishkek.

From 2015 to 2018, she was Deputy, Deputy Torag of the Jogorku Kenesh of the Kyrgyz Republic, Bishkek.

From 2018 to 2020, she held the position of Deputy Prime Minister of the Government of the Kyrgyz Republic.

On October 1, 2021, she was appointed Director of the EEC Department for Labor Migration and Social Protection.
